!44 Gauges 140-160 1972

Looks like you were correct! I climbed into the footwell after partially removing the knee panel. I found one of the tiny 4mm bolts is loose but with the gauge still in place and the minimal space to work with I couldnt get the torque required to tighen it back in place.
It looks to me to remove the gauge I unplug all the wires and the spedo cable undo the 2 hold down bolts then slide it into the dash then sideways to the passengers side. then pulling the left hand end of the gauge out first. Is this correct?
